10 Steps to Landing Your Dream Job in Optometry

In today’s competitive healthcare landscape, finding the right optometry job can be both exciting and overwhelming. Whether you're newly qualified or seeking your next challenge, taking a strategic approach will help you secure the ideal role. This guide outlines 10 practical steps to help you land your dream job in optometry – including tips for those searching for optometry jobs near me.

1. Define Your Ideal Role

Start by identifying what you want from your next position. Do you prefer working in a high-street practice, a hospital setting, or a specialist clinic? Think about location, working hours, patient demographics, and clinical responsibilities.

2. Update Your CV and LinkedIn Profile

Make sure your CV highlights your most recent clinical experience, technical skills, and achievements. Use keywords like “optometry” and relevant procedures to boost visibility. Also, keep your LinkedIn profile up to date – many employers and recruiters use it to source candidates.

3. Register with a Specialist Optometry Recruiter

4. Consider Your Location Preferences

If you’ve found yourself typing “optometry jobs near me” into Google, think about how flexible you are on location. Expanding your search area – even slightly – can open up significantly more opportunities.

5. Research Potential Employers

Take time to learn about the companies or practices you’re applying to. Look at their values, work culture, and patient feedback. Tailoring your application to align with their ethos will help you stand out.

6. Prepare for Interviews Thoroughly

Be ready to discuss clinical scenarios, your approach to patient care, and how you stay up to date with the latest guidelines. Employers will also want to assess your communication skills and cultural fit.

7. Stay Informed on Industry Trends

Being aware of current developments in optometry – such as evolving technology or changes to GOC guidelines – shows that you’re proactive and invested in your profession.

8. Consider Further Qualifications

If you’re looking to advance your career or specialise, additional certifications in areas like glaucoma management or independent prescribing can make you more competitive.

9. Use Job Boards Wisely

While job boards can be useful, they’re often saturated. Working with a recruiter or checking directly with companies can lead to better-targeted opportunities for optometry jobs near me.

10. Be Persistent and Stay Positive

Rejections happen, but they’re not a reflection of your potential. Keep refining your approach, seek feedback, and stay in touch with recruiters to remain top of mind when the right role comes up.
